Solution for 19x-12-4a=57 equation:


Simplifying
19x + -12 + -4a = 57

Reorder the terms:
-12 + -4a + 19x = 57

Solving
-12 + -4a + 19x = 57

Solving for variable 'a'.

Move all terms containing a to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'12' to each side of the equation.
-12 + -4a + 12 + 19x = 57 + 12

Reorder the terms:
-12 + 12 + -4a + 19x = 57 + 12

Combine like terms: -12 + 12 = 0
0 + -4a + 19x = 57 + 12
-4a + 19x = 57 + 12

Combine like terms: 57 + 12 = 69
-4a + 19x = 69

Add '-19x' to each side of the equation.
-4a + 19x + -19x = 69 + -19x

Combine like terms: 19x + -19x = 0
-4a + 0 = 69 + -19x
-4a = 69 + -19x

Divide each side by '-4'.
a = -17.25 + 4.75x

Simplifying
a = -17.25 + 4.75x
